Output 64b37343280116b0bc3480bf05b10ce53bde0738a68ae041c80398e770980ccb:8

value
7620510433
script pubkey
OP_0 OP_PUSHBYTES_32 cd238c31103c89f5e40dfb9b7e25ea1ea28568f25f19d15c0ee1da994885755e
address
bc1qe53ccvgs8jylteqdlwdhuf02r63g268jtuvazhqwu8dfjjy9w40qw0ulcd
transaction
64b37343280116b0bc3480bf05b10ce53bde0738a68ae041c80398e770980ccb
confirmations
258901
spent
true